Volume testing


In this chapter, we have used the Apex code to generate additional data to explore how the platform applies indexes and the use of Batch Apex. It is important to always perform some volume testing even if it is just with at least 200 records to ensure that your Triggers are bulkified. Testing with more than this gives you a better idea of other limitations in your software search, such as query performance and any Visualforce scalability issues.

One of the biggest pitfalls with volume testing is the quality of the test data. It is not often that easy to get hold of actual customer data, so we must emulate the spread of information by varying field values amongst the records to properly simulate how the software will not only behave under load with more records, but under load with a different dispersion of values.
